#db6ed7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db6ed7 is composed of 85.9% red, 43.1%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.8% magenta, 1.8%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 302.2 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 64.5%. #db6ed7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#b700af.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#db6ed7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c030c is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#db6ed7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aa9faa is the less saturated color, while #fe4bf7 is the most saturated one.
